Nancy Pearcey: “The Toxic War on Masculinity”
Heralded as “America’s pre-eminent evangelical Protestant female intellectual,” Nancy Pearcey is the author of the 2023 The Toxic War on Masculinity: How Christianity Reconciles the Sexes. Earlier books include Total Truth; The Soul of Science; How Now Shall We Live; Saving Leonardo: A Call to Resist the Secular Assault on Minds, Morals, and Meaning.
She is a fellow of Discovery Institute’s Center for Science and Culture and a professor and scholar in residence at Houston Baptist University, where she is director of the Francis Schaeffer Center for Worldview and Culture. She was founding editor of “Break Point” where she wrote over a thousand commentaries and headed up the team of writers. For seven years she coauthored a monthly column with Chuck Colson.
Pearcey has addressed staffers on Capitol Hill and at the White House; actors and screenwriters in Hollywood; scientists at Sandia and Los Alamos National Laboratories; artists at the International Arts Movement; students and faculty at universities such as Princeton, Stanford, Dartmouth, USC, U of GA, and St. John’s College; and educational and activist groups, including the Heritage Foundation in Washington, D.C.
